Discovering the Benefits of Hobbies: Why They’re Good for You

Engaging in hobbies has numerous physical and mental benefits. On a physical level, hobbies can help improve our overall fitness and well-being. Active hobbies such as hiking, biking, or dancing can increase cardiovascular health, strengthen muscles, and aid in weight loss. These activities also release endorphins, which are natural mood boosters that can reduce stress and anxiety.

Mentally, hobbies provide an outlet for creativity and self-expression. Creative hobbies such as painting, drawing, or pottery allow us to tap into our artistic side and explore new ways of thinking. Engaging in these activities can improve focus and concentration while providing a sense of accomplishment and pride in our creations.

From Painting to Pottery: Creative Hobbies to Explore

Creative hobbies offer a wide range of benefits beyond just artistic expression. Painting, for example, has been shown to reduce stress levels and promote relaxation. It allows individuals to express their emotions and thoughts through color and form. Drawing is another creative hobby that can improve focus and attention to detail. It can also be a form of meditation as it requires concentration and mindfulness.

Pottery is a hands-on creative hobby that offers both physical and mental benefits. It requires focus and patience as individuals mold clay into various shapes and forms. Pottery can be therapeutic as it allows individuals to release tension and express themselves through the tactile experience of working with clay.

Get Your Heart Pumping: Active Hobbies for Fitness Enthusiasts

For those who enjoy staying active and improving their physical fitness, there are a variety of hobbies to explore. Hiking is a popular outdoor activity that not only provides a great workout but also allows individuals to connect with nature and enjoy beautiful scenery. Biking is another active hobby that can be done solo or with friends and family. It improves cardiovascular health, strengthens leg muscles, and can be a fun way to explore new areas.

Dancing is a hobby that combines physical activity with artistic expression. It improves coordination, balance, and flexibility while providing an outlet for creativity. Whether it’s salsa, hip-hop, or ballroom dancing, there are various styles to choose from that cater to different interests and skill levels.

A Taste of Something New: Culinary Hobbies to Try at Home

Culinary hobbies offer a delicious way to explore new flavors and techniques in the kitchen. Baking, for example, allows individuals to create sweet treats and pastries from scratch. It can be a therapeutic activity that requires precision and attention to detail. Cooking is another culinary hobby that allows individuals to experiment with different ingredients and flavors. It can be a creative outlet as individuals develop their own recipes and techniques.

Brewing is a hobby that has gained popularity in recent years. It involves the process of making beer or other fermented beverages at home. Brewing allows individuals to experiment with different ingredients and flavors while learning about the science behind fermentation.

Nature-based hobbies provide an opportunity to connect with the natural world and appreciate its beauty. Camping is a popular outdoor activity that allows individuals to escape the hustle and bustle of everyday life and immerse themselves in nature. It provides an opportunity for relaxation, reflection, and rejuvenation.

Birdwatching is a hobby that can be done in any outdoor setting, from your own backyard to national parks. It allows individuals to observe and learn about different bird species while enjoying the peacefulness of nature. Gardening is another nature-based hobby that offers both physical and mental benefits. It provides a sense of accomplishment as individuals nurture plants and watch them grow. Gardening also promotes relaxation and reduces stress levels.

Mindful Pursuits: Relaxing Hobbies to Help You Unwind

In today’s fast-paced world, it’s important to find activities that promote relaxation and mindfulness. Yoga is a popular hobby that combines physical movement with mental focus and breath control. It improves flexibility, strength, and balance while reducing stress and promoting relaxation.

Meditation is another mindful pursuit that can be done anywhere, anytime. It involves focusing the mind and achieving a state of deep relaxation and inner peace. Meditation has been shown to reduce stress, improve mental clarity, and promote overall well-being.

Journaling is a relaxing hobby that allows individuals to express their thoughts and emotions on paper. It can be a form of self-reflection and self-discovery as individuals explore their inner thoughts and feelings. Journaling can also serve as a creative outlet as individuals experiment with different writing styles and techniques.

Tech-Savvy Hobbies: Exploring the Digital World

In today’s digital age, there are numerous tech-savvy hobbies to explore. Coding is a hobby that involves writing computer programs and developing software applications. It improves problem-solving skills, logical thinking, and creativity. Video editing is another tech-savvy hobby that allows individuals to create and edit videos using various software programs. It can be a creative outlet as individuals experiment with different visual effects and storytelling techniques.

Gaming is a popular hobby that allows individuals to immerse themselves in virtual worlds and engage in interactive experiences. It can improve hand-eye coordination, problem-solving skills, and strategic thinking. Gaming also provides an opportunity for social interaction as individuals connect with other players online.

Musical Endeavors: Learning an Instrument or Singing

Learning to play a musical instrument or sing is a hobby that offers numerous benefits. It improves cognitive function, memory, and coordination. Playing an instrument requires focus and discipline, which can transfer to other areas of life. It also provides an outlet for self-expression and creativity.

Singing is another musical hobby that can be done solo or in a group setting. It improves lung capacity, posture, and vocal control. Singing has been shown to reduce stress levels and promote relaxation. It can also be a form of emotional release as individuals express their feelings through song.

Hobbies for Animal Lovers: Caring for Pets and Wildlife

For animal lovers, there are various hobbies that allow individuals to connect with and care for animals. Pet-sitting is a hobby that involves taking care of pets while their owners are away. It provides an opportunity to spend time with animals and experience the joy they bring.

Volunteering at an animal shelter is another hobby that allows individuals to make a positive impact on the lives of animals in need. It provides an opportunity to help with feeding, grooming, and socializing animals while promoting their well-being.

Birdwatching is a hobby that allows individuals to observe and learn about different bird species in their natural habitats. It provides an opportunity to connect with nature and appreciate the beauty of birds.

Hobbies for the Curious: Exploring Science, History, and Culture

For those who have a thirst for knowledge and a curiosity about the world, there are various hobbies to explore. Reading is a hobby that allows individuals to explore different genres and topics while expanding their knowledge and imagination. It improves vocabulary, critical thinking skills, and empathy.

Visiting museums is another hobby that allows individuals to learn about history, art, and culture. It provides an opportunity to appreciate and understand different perspectives and traditions. Learning a new language is a hobby that opens doors to new cultures and experiences. It improves cognitive function, memory, and communication skills.
